Insights into Travel + Leisure's Greenhouse Gas Emissions Pathways

As of 2023, Travel + Leisure has set gre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ions reduction targets that cover its operational emissions (Scope 1 and 2), but not its value chain emissions (Scope 3). This means its reduction efforts currently focus on direct and purchased energy emissions.

Does Travel + Leisure have a target to reduce the emissions from its operations?

As of 2023, Travel + Leisure has set a target to reduce its operational gre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ions, specifically those from Scope 1 and Scope 2 sources.

Travel + Leisure's most ambitious operational target is to reduce these emissions by 40% by 2025, compared to a baseline of 0.008 Metric Tonnes of CO2 equivalent (mtCO2e) per Square Feet (ft2) in 2010.

As of 2023, Travel + Leisure is ahead of schedule on its operational emissions reduction target, having achieved 96.38% of the planned reduction.
